Genetic variation in the growth hormone synthesis pathway in relation to circulating insulin-like growth factor-I, insulin-like growth factor binding protein-3, and breast cancer risk: results from the European prospective investigation into cancer and nutrition study.
Insulin-like growth factor-I (IGF-I) stimulates cell proliferation and can enhance the development of tumors in different organs.
